In today's digital landscape, SEO isn't just a buzzword; it's the backbone of online visibility and sustainable growth. Whether you're a seasoned marketer or a budding entrepreneur, understanding the nuances of Search Engine Optimization (SEO), Programmatic SEO, SaaS SEO, and SCaaS is crucial. Let's dive deep into each of these strategies to help you unlock your business's full potential. We'll explore how they work, why they matter, and how you can implement them effectively.

    Understanding Traditional SEO

    At its core, SEO is about optimizing your website to rank higher in search engine results pages (SERPs) like Google, Bing, and Yahoo. The higher your ranking, the more organic (unpaid) traffic you'll attract. This involves a multifaceted approach, including keyword research, on-page optimization, off-page optimization, and technical SEO. Let's break down these components:

    Keyword Research

    Keyword research is the foundation of any successful SEO strategy. It involves identifying the terms and phrases your target audience uses when searching for products, services, or information related to your business. Tools like Google Keyword Planner, Ahrefs, SEMrush, and Moz Keyword Explorer can help you uncover valuable keywords. When selecting keywords, consider their search volume, competition, and relevance to your business. Focus on a mix of long-tail keywords (longer, more specific phrases) and short-tail keywords (broader, more general terms) to capture a wider audience.

    On-Page Optimization

    On-page optimization refers to the practice of optimizing elements within your website to improve its ranking and user experience. Key on-page factors include:

    • Title Tags: Craft compelling and keyword-rich title tags for each page of your website. Keep them under 60 characters to ensure they display properly in search results.
    • Meta Descriptions: Write concise and engaging meta descriptions that accurately summarize the content of each page. Aim for around 150-160 characters to encourage clicks from the SERPs.
    • Header Tags (H1-H6): Use header tags to structure your content logically and highlight important keywords. The H1 tag should be used for the main title of the page, and subsequent header tags should be used for subheadings.
    • Content Quality: Create high-quality, informative, and engaging content that provides value to your audience. Focus on answering their questions and addressing their needs. Incorporate relevant keywords naturally throughout your content.
    • Image Optimization: Optimize images by compressing them to reduce file size and adding descriptive alt text. This helps improve page load speed and provides search engines with context about the image.
    • Internal Linking: Link to other relevant pages within your website to improve navigation and distribute link equity. This helps search engines understand the structure of your site and discover new content.
    • URL Structure: Create clean, descriptive URLs that include relevant keywords. Avoid using long, complex URLs with unnecessary characters.

    Off-Page Optimization

    Off-page optimization involves building your website's authority and reputation through external factors. The most important off-page factor is link building, which involves acquiring backlinks from other reputable websites. Backlinks are essentially votes of confidence from other sites, signaling to search engines that your website is trustworthy and valuable. Other off-page factors include social media marketing, brand mentions, and online reviews.

    Technical SEO

    Technical SEO focuses on optimizing the technical aspects of your website to improve its crawlability, indexability, and overall performance. Key technical SEO factors include:

    • Website Speed: Optimize your website's loading speed by compressing images, leveraging browser caching, and using a Content Delivery Network (CDN).
    • Mobile-Friendliness: Ensure your website is mobile-friendly and provides a seamless user experience on all devices. Use a responsive design that adapts to different screen sizes.
    • Site Architecture: Create a clear and logical site architecture that makes it easy for search engines to crawl and index your website.
    • XML Sitemap: Submit an XML sitemap to search engines to help them discover and index all the pages on your website.
    • Robots.txt: Use a robots.txt file to instruct search engines on which pages to crawl and which to ignore.
    • HTTPS: Secure your website with HTTPS to protect user data and improve search engine rankings.

    The Power of Programmatic SEO

    Now that we've covered traditional SEO, let's move on to Programmatic SEO. This is an advanced strategy that leverages automation and data to create and optimize a large number of pages targeting specific keywords and search queries. In essence, it's about using templates and data feeds to generate optimized content at scale. Guys, this method is super efficient for businesses targeting a wide range of niche keywords or locations.

    How Programmatic SEO Works

    Programmatic SEO typically involves the following steps:

    1. Identify Target Keywords: Conduct extensive keyword research to identify a wide range of long-tail keywords and search queries that are relevant to your business.
    2. Create Content Templates: Develop content templates that can be dynamically populated with data. These templates should be optimized for the target keywords and provide valuable information to users.
    3. Data Integration: Integrate your content templates with data sources, such as databases, APIs, or spreadsheets. This allows you to automatically generate content for each keyword or search query.
    4. Automation: Use automation tools to generate and publish the content at scale. This can involve using custom scripts, SEO platforms, or content management systems (CMS).
    5. Optimization: Continuously monitor and optimize the performance of your programmatic SEO campaigns. This includes tracking keyword rankings, traffic, and conversions, and making adjustments as needed.

    Benefits of Programmatic SEO

    • Scale: Generate a large number of optimized pages quickly and efficiently.
    • Targeted Traffic: Attract highly targeted traffic from long-tail keywords and niche search queries.
    • Efficiency: Automate the content creation process and free up resources for other marketing activities.
    • Improved Rankings: Improve your website's overall search engine rankings by targeting a wider range of keywords.

    Example of Programmatic SEO

    Let's say you run a real estate website that lists properties for sale in different cities. You could use programmatic SEO to generate pages for each city, neighborhood, and property type. For example, you could create pages like "Apartments for sale in Downtown Chicago," "Houses for sale in Lincoln Park," or "Condos for sale near Wrigleyville." These pages would be automatically populated with data from your real estate database, including property listings, photos, and descriptions.

    SaaS SEO: Optimizing for Software as a Service

    SaaS SEO focuses on optimizing websites for Software as a Service (SaaS) companies. SaaS businesses have unique SEO challenges and opportunities compared to traditional businesses. For example, SaaS websites often have complex navigation, limited content, and a focus on lead generation rather than e-commerce. Therefore, SaaS SEO requires a specialized approach.

    Key Considerations for SaaS SEO

    • Keyword Research: Focus on keywords related to the problems your software solves and the benefits it provides. Target both informational and transactional keywords to attract users at different stages of the buying cycle.
    • Content Marketing: Create high-quality content that educates your target audience, showcases your software's features, and demonstrates its value. This can include blog posts, case studies, white papers, and webinars.
    • Landing Page Optimization: Optimize your landing pages to convert visitors into leads and customers. Use clear and compelling calls to action, highlight key features, and provide social proof.
    • Product Pages: Create detailed and informative product pages that showcase the features, benefits, and pricing of your software. Use screenshots, videos, and customer testimonials to make your product more appealing.
    • Technical SEO: Ensure your website is fast, mobile-friendly, and easy to crawl and index. Pay attention to site architecture, URL structure, and internal linking.

    Strategies to boost SaaS SEO

    Content is king. Develop a content strategy that focuses on providing value to your target audience. Blog posts, whitepapers, case studies, and webinars can help attract and engage potential customers. Optimize each piece of content for relevant keywords to improve search engine visibility.

    Focus on user experience. Ensure your website is easy to navigate, mobile-friendly, and loads quickly. A positive user experience can improve engagement metrics, such as time on page and bounce rate, which can positively impact your search engine rankings.

    Build high-quality backlinks. Backlinks are an important ranking factor for search engines. Earn backlinks from reputable websites in your industry to improve your website's authority and visibility.

    SCaaS: The Rise of SEO-as-a-Service

    SCaaS, or SEO-as-a-Service, represents a growing trend in the SEO industry. It involves outsourcing your SEO efforts to a specialized service provider who offers a comprehensive suite of SEO tools, services, and expertise on a subscription basis. This model can be particularly appealing to small and medium-sized businesses (SMBs) that lack the internal resources or expertise to manage their own SEO campaigns.

    Benefits of SCaaS

    • Cost-Effectiveness: SCaaS can be more cost-effective than hiring an in-house SEO team, as you only pay for the services you need.
    • Expertise: SCaaS providers have specialized expertise in SEO and can bring a wealth of knowledge and experience to your campaigns.
    • Scalability: SCaaS allows you to scale your SEO efforts up or down as needed, without having to hire or fire employees.
    • Technology: SCaaS providers typically have access to advanced SEO tools and technologies that can help you improve your website's rankings and visibility.

    Choosing an SCaaS Provider

    When selecting an SCaaS provider, consider the following factors:

    • Experience: Look for a provider with a proven track record of success in your industry.
    • Expertise: Ensure the provider has expertise in all areas of SEO, including keyword research, on-page optimization, off-page optimization, and technical SEO.
    • Technology: Choose a provider that has access to advanced SEO tools and technologies.
    • Reporting: Make sure the provider provides regular reports on the performance of your SEO campaigns.
    • Pricing: Compare the pricing of different SCaaS providers and choose one that fits your budget.

    Integrating SEO, Programmatic SEO, SaaS SEO, and SCaaS

    These strategies aren't mutually exclusive; in fact, they can be incredibly powerful when integrated. For a SaaS company, using programmatic SEO to generate landing pages for various features or use cases can significantly expand reach. Meanwhile, leveraging an SCaaS provider can streamline the technical and ongoing aspects of SEO, allowing internal teams to focus on content and strategy. Understanding how these elements work together can create a synergistic effect, driving more traffic, leads, and ultimately, revenue.

    In conclusion, mastering SEO, Programmatic SEO, SaaS SEO, and understanding the benefits of SCaaS are vital for any business looking to thrive online. By implementing these strategies effectively, you can significantly improve your website's visibility, attract more targeted traffic, and achieve your business goals. Keep experimenting and refining your approach to stay ahead in the ever-evolving world of search engine optimization.